Output d359febc664220a235f757be13b7efaeb93d26cc331b4a898aa87f04eacf3b86:0

value
2087639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c526aa24074a7afaecc01533ade3ed14b124127a OP_EQUAL
address
3KfTMoH67QzE5TLo5FifrkLybN3FGJgFof
transaction
d359febc664220a235f757be13b7efaeb93d26cc331b4a898aa87f04eacf3b86
spent
true